Fill in the blank with the appropriate subordinating conjunction that correctly completes the concessive clause in the sentence below.
Answer:Difficult 【as】 the final examination appeared to the graduating students, every candidate in the honors class managed to pass with distinction.
Answer
as
The word 'as' (or 'though') correctly completes the inverted concessive clause structure. In formal English syntax, placing an adjective at the beginning of a clause followed by 'as' or 'though' creates a concessive relationship meaning 'although it was difficult'.
Step-by-Step Solution
Key Concept
Concessive clause inversion using 'Adjective + as / though + Subject + Verb'
